Depends on what you want to do with the previous responses. eg. if piping survey 1 responses back into survey 2, could perhaps try: * Basing the "survey 2 distribution list" off the survey 1 data / csv file (ie. leaving in individual records with contact details + key survey 1 responses) * Then, build in embedded variables into survey 2, that are based off "survey 1 response" data fields * Then pipe these into the latest survey
